Pier 1 Recalls Glassware


May 8, 2007
Pier 1 Imports is recalling about 180,000 orange and red glassware pieces. The glassware can crack or break unexpectedly, posing a laceration hazard.

Pier 1 Imports has received 17 reports of glassware that cracked or broke. One injury involving minor cuts from broken glass has been reported.

The recalled glassware pieces involve large and small tumblers, goblets and margaritas. The bottom half of the tumblers is red and the top half is orange. The bottom of the margaritas and the goblets is clear and the top is red and orange.

The glassware sold by Pier 1 Imports stores nationwide, on its Web site, and in their April 2007 catalog from January 2007 through April 2007 for about $6 each.

Consumers should stop using the glassware pieces immediately and return them to their nearest Pier 1 Imports retail store for a refund or merchandise credit.

Consumer Contact: For additional information consumers can contact Pier 1 Imports at (800) 245-4595 between 8 a.m. and 11 p.m. CT Monday through Saturday and between 9 a.m. to 9 p.m. Sunday, or visit the firms Web site at www.pier1.com.

The recall is being conducted in cooperation with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C).
